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3884 3716865826 580518015
187915800 387671339 9580687
187915800 387671339 9580687
870192 0270133 797
All about undefined
Interested in learning more?
187915800 387671339 9580687
870192 0270133 797
See more
73292510823 318749679
9862 3217 54321419
See more
5329 26849889 326
04831 60 12 140068779
See more